CVE-2016-2060

26
FAUCET Score

CVE-2016-2060 describes a critical vulnerability in the tethering controller (server/TetherController.cpp) of netd, affecting Android devices utilizing Qualcomm Innovation Center (QuIC) contributions. This flaw allows attackers to bypass access restrictions by manipulating upstream interface names through a crafted application. With a CVSS v3 score of 7.8 (High), the vulnerability has a low attack complexity and requires user interaction (UI:R), but could lead to high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impacts (C:H/I:H/A:H). While not listed in CISA's KEV catalog and lacking public exploit code in Metasploit, Nuclei, or ExploitDB, there is significant community discussion and media coverage, including reports of a critical vulnerability affecting a large percentage of Android devices.
